Essential Insights into Honey Badger Eating Habits

Building on our overview of the honey badger, it’s essential to understand their unique eating habits. Honey badgers are opportunistic feeders, which means they will consume whatever is available in their habitat, influenced by seasonal changes and food abundance. This adaptability is key to their survival in diverse ecosystems, from savannahs to dense forests.

Understanding Honey Badger Nutritional Needs

The honey badger’s nutritional needs encompass a balance of proteins, fats, and carbohydrates. Predominantly carnivorous, they will actively hunt small mammals such as rodents and birds, but they are also known to forage for fruits, grubs, and insects. Their omnivorous diet allows them to meet their energy needs throughout various seasons, establishing their role at multiple levels in the food chain.

Moreover, honey badgers possess a remarkable digestive system, adapted to break down tough and varied diets. This adaptability allows them to thrive even in environments where food scarcity is a challenge. Understanding these nutritional needs is vital for conservationists when planning dietary supplements or habitats that support their natural food sources.

Honey Badger Foraging Patterns

Honey badgers exhibit specific foraging behavior that enables them to locate food efficiently. They keenly use their acute sense of smell to find buried prey, and their strong claws help them dig into the earth to uncover or excavate food sources like insects and small mammals. These foraging patterns are not random; they are heavily influenced by the availability of prey.

Several studies have documented their adaptation to seasonal diets, shifting from hunting mammals to scavenging carrion during leaner times. This behavioral flexibility is particularly important in their ecosystems, where food resource management is critical for maintaining population dynamics.

Q&A: Common Questions About Honey Badger Diet and Health

What is the primary diet of honey badgers?

Honey badgers primarily consume small mammals, insects, reptiles, and carrion. Their omnivorous diet allows them to adapt to varying food availability in their habitat.

How does the honey badger’s hunting behavior contribute to its diet?

The honey badger’s hunting behavior is highly opportunistic, which enables it to catch a wide range of prey. Their exceptional digging abilities and keen sense of smell assist in locating hidden or buried food sources.

What are the seasonal variations in honey badger diets?

Honey badgers’ diets often vary with the seasons. During the rainy season, they may have access to a broader range of food options, including insects and fruits, while in drought seasons, they may rely more on scavenging.

How can habitat destruction affect honey badger diets?

Habitat destruction can lead to reduced prey availability, thereby impacting honey badger nutrition. A decline in food resources may necessitate shifts in foraging behavior, which could affect their overall health and survival.

What are some effective conservation strategies for honey badgers?

Effective conservation strategies include habitat restoration, promoting biodiversity, educating local communities about their ecological roles, and establishing protected areas to ensure these nocturnal creatures have access to their natural dietary needs.
